Not a great film


Noted writer and film director Humayun Ahmed is a household name in our country and people have high expectations from him. No matter whether it's a drama, novel or a film--his works are highly rated, sometimes over rated. He is probably the best writer of this country with a sharp sense of humour-- there's no doubt about it. All of his works have a long lasting impact on people's minds. How can we forget his character Baker bhai from the drama serial "Kothao Keu Nei" which is still fresh in our memory? In fact his writing has always appealed to the masses, especially the middle class people. No other writer has depicted the life of the middle class so perfectly like Humayun Ahmed. Therefore it's natural that all his works create enough hype in the media. Whenever it's a Humayun Ahmed film, the curiosity factor is always there. And why not? I last watched his movie "Shamol Chhaya" which was based on our liberation war and the writer portrayed the glorious war with his brilliant sense of humour. Definitely, it was a job very well done by Humayun.

But what kind of a comedy film he has made this time in the form of ' Noy Number Bipod Sangket'? I saw a full house audience at the Bashundhara Cineplex. But after watching the film, all of them felt that it was a comedy devoid of genuine fun! All of them had a high expectation from this movie since it created enough hype in the media but later turned out to be a dull affair. Humayun Ahmed himself termed the movie as a pure entertainment based comedy.

The movie has offered very little to the viewers.
